The Legal Framework: Article 234
The primary legal instrument governing steroids in Russia is Article 234 of the Criminal Code of the Russian Federation. This short article deals with the "Illegal Circulation of Potent or Poisonous Substances for the Purpose of Sale."
Steorids are classified as "Potent Substances" (Sil'nodeystvuyushchiye veshchestva). Under this law:
- Production and Sale: Manufacturing or selling steroids without a pharmaceutical license is a felony punishable by heavy fines, corrective labor, or jail time.
- Smuggling: Bringing steroids into Russia from abroad (e.g., ordering online from another nation) can be classified under Article 226.1, which carries even harsher penalties for "Smuggling of Potent Substances."
- Personal Use: While the law mainly targets sellers, belongings of a "big scale" (determined by weight in grams) can lead to criminal charges even if there is no proof of intent to offer.

The Modern Pharmacy Market
While it is in theory possible to discover AAS in Russian drug stores, it is functionally difficult for a casual purchaser or a foreign national to do so legally. The majority of anabolic representatives now need a "Red Stamp" prescription-- an unique kind used for narcotics and high-potency drugs that is strictly tracked by the Ministry of Health.
- Digitization: Most Russian pharmacies have actually relocated to electronic record-keeping. Every sale of a powerful substance is logged against a physician's ID and the patient's medical records.
- Availability: Even with a prescription, many pharmacies no longer stock steroids like Testosterone Enanthate or Deca-Durabolin, as the administrative problem of bring them outweighs the revenue.

The Risks of Purchasing Steroids in Russia
Those thinking about the procurement of AAS within Russian borders deal with a trifecta of risks: legal, health, and monetary.
1. Police Oversight
The Russian Federal Drug Control Service (FSKN was combined into the Ministry of Internal Affairs) is highly active. "Sting" operations prevail on social networks platforms like VKontakte or Telegram. Getting from an unproven source typically results in an "arrest on delivery" circumstance.
2. Fake and Low-Quality Products
Russia has a considerable market for fake pharmaceuticals. Products identified as "pharmaceutical grade" are often produced in unsanitary underground conditions.
- Heavy Metal Contamination: Unregulated production frequently uses inexpensive solvents and low-grade basic materials.
- Incorrect Dosing: Under-dosed products lead to poor results, while over-dosed items can cause acute health crises.
3. Custom-mades and Border Control
For immigrants, the threat is intensified. Russian customizeds use sophisticated X-ray and scanning innovation. Trying to leave the country with steroids-- even if they were acquired "under the counter" at a regional health club-- is considered smuggling of powerful compounds out of the nation, which can result in immediate detention and long-term jail time.
